Maldives’ first Movenpick resort slated for 2018 launch

When the 105-unit Mӧvenpick Resort & Spa Kuredhivaru Maldives opens in 2Q2018, it will mark the first resort in the Maldives for Swiss hospitality company.

Situated on the remote Kuredhivaru Island in Noonu Atoll, in the exclusive northern part of the Maldives, the contemporary tropical resort will feature 33 beach villas and 72 over-water villas.

Resort facilities will include a luxurious spa with 14 private treatment rooms, a yoga pavilion, gym, volleyball and tennis courts, in addition to a business centre, library and retail boutique.

The resort will feature a comprehensive dive centre, beach sports activity centre, exclusive guest-only superyacht, as well as a small-scale marine research centre and private marina.

The first Marine National Park in the Maldives, which consists of a group of nine uninhabited islands commonly known as Edu Faru, is approximately 15 minutes from the resort via speedboat. The popular Christmas Tree Rock and Orimas Thila dive sites are also a boat ride away.
